About the position

As a Front Line Manufacturing Manager at Amgen, you will play a crucial role in overseeing the downstream manufacturing operations within a state-of-the-art drug substance manufacturing facility. This position involves managing a team of manufacturing associates, ensuring compliance with safety and regulatory standards, and fostering a culture of continuous improvement. You will be responsible for leading production activities, mentoring staff, and collaborating with cross-functional teams to optimize manufacturing processes and achieve operational goals.
